Sean Flynn, Errol Flynn’s son

Sean Flynn was a B-movie actor until he became bored with trying to replicate his father’s success. He became a photo-journalist & was hired by Time to cover the Vietnam War in the late 1960’s. In 1970 he & a fellow journalist went into Cambodia to cover the recent action there. They were captured by the viet cong & turned over to the Khmer Rouge. Various reports said they were held for nearly a year until being executed by the KhmerRouge. Many people over the years tried to find his remains. Reports that they had been found turned out to be false. He is one of the many still missing from that crummy war.
